Performing Basic Checks

Before diving into complex solutions, it’s essential to perform basic checks. Inspect your device for physical damage, remove any screen protectors hindering touch sensitivity, and try a simple restart to eliminate temporary glitches.

iPhone XS Max Touch Screen Not Working Check for Physical Damage

Take a closer look at your iPhone XS Max. Is the screen cracked or damaged in any way? Even minor damage can affect the touchscreen’s functionality. If you notice any physical damage, it might be time to consider a repair. Remember, continuing to use a damaged iPhone can lead to additional problems down the line.

Restore iPhone XS Max with iTunes

If all else fails, restoring your iPhone XS Max with iTunes is a more drastic step, but it can effectively address deep-rooted software issues. First, ensure you have the latest version of iTunes installed on your computer. Then, connect your iPhone to your computer using a USB cable and launch iTunes. You’ll need to put your iPhone in recovery mode for this to work. On the iPhone XS Max, quickly press and release the volume up button, then the volume down button, followed by pressing and holding the side button until you see the recovery mode screen. Once in recovery mode, iTunes will give you the option to Restore or Update your iPhone. Choose Restore, and iTunes will download the software for your device and restore it to factory settings. Remember, this process will erase all data on your iPhone, so it’s essential to have a backup before proceeding.
